Percona University April 2019We started hosting Percona University a few years back with the aim of sharing knowledge with the open source database community. The events are held in cities across the world. The next Percona University days will visiting Uruguay, Argentina, and Brazil, in a lightning tour at the end of April.

  • Montevideo, Tuesday, April 23 2019 from 8.30am to 6.30pm
  • Buenos Aires, Thursday, April 25 2019 from 1.30pm to 10.3pm
  • São Paulo, Saturday, April 27 2019 from 9.30am to 7.30pm

What is Percona University?

It is a technical educational event. We encourage people to join us at any point during these talks – we understand that not everyone can take off a half a day from their work or studies. As long as you register – that’s essential.

Does the word “University” mean that we won’t cover any in-depth topics, and these events would only interest college/university students?

No, it doesn’t. We designed Percona University presentations for all kinds of “students,” including professionals with years of database industry experience. The word “University” means that this event series is about educating attendees on technical topics (it’s not a sales-oriented event, it’s about sharing knowledge with the community).

Does Percona University cover only Percona technology?

We will definitely mention Percona technology, but we will also focus on real-world technical issues and recommend solutions that work (regardless of whether Percona developed them).
